Anthony Roth Costanzo Appointed General Director of Opera Philadelphia
The celebrated countertenor will lead the company starting June 1, bringing a unique blend of performance and administrative expertise to the role.
- Anthony Roth Costanzo, a renowned countertenor, has been named the new general director and president of Opera Philadelphia, effective June 1.
- Costanzo's appointment marks a significant shift as he brings a performer's perspective to the leadership role, aiming to innovate and expand the company's reach.
- His plans include enhancing fundraising efforts, establishing strategic partnerships, and focusing on new works and collaborations both within and outside the traditional opera sphere.
- Costanzo has a history with Opera Philadelphia, including notable performances and production roles, which he aims to leverage to reinvigorate the company and attract new audiences.
- The appointment comes at a challenging time for the arts, with Opera Philadelphia facing economic pressures and a need for innovative approaches to audience engagement and programming.
